The Ontario Health Coalition (OHC) is holding public hearings across the province to get the public’s input into recommendations for the future of our small, rural and northern community hospitals.

A hearing will be held in Chesley on Tuesday, June 18.

Community Invited to Provide Input at Public Hearing in Chesley on Rural Hospitals

In response to more than 1,200 closures of emergency departments and other local hospital services over the last year, the Ontario Health Coalition (OHC) is holding public hearings across Ontario to develop recommendations for the future of our local hospitals, including small, rural and northern community hospitals.…
